- The care of farm animals is a thing of great importance. There is great care taken of a cow because she gives us milk and this is good especially for the young. A cow is a pet in every home. All cows are called by various names such as Jack, Lavin, or Polley. When driving the cows to the pasture land they are sometimes called, ''pugging'' or [?]. When a cow calves some farmers let the calf get a suck on the cow.(continues on next page)
